Everything needed to run a comprehensive dev environment.
Just type X_ and pick a service from autocomplete;
new dev modules will be added as they are built.
The only dev service not included in the uber jar is xapi-dev-maven,
as it includes all runtime dependencies of maven, adding ~4 seconds to build time,
and 6 megabytes to the final output jar size (without xapi-dev-maven, it's ~1MB).

package xapi.annotation.gwt;
import static java.lang.annotation.ElementType.METHOD;
import static java.lang.annotation.RetentionPolicy.CLASS;
import java.lang.annotation.Documented;
import java.lang.annotation.Retention;
import java.lang.annotation.Target;
/**
* This is a marker type for method that are "magic", aka, replaced by the
* Gwt compiler. Use the {@link #doNotVisit()} method to tell the compiler
* that the body of the method should not be visited.
*
* @author "James X. Nelson ([email protected])"
*
*/
@Documented
@Retention(CLASS)
@Target(METHOD)
public @interface MagicMethod {
String documentation() default "";
boolean doNotVisit() default true;
}
